H.R.6694 - FHA Seller-Financed Downpayment Reform and Risk-Based Pricing Authorization Act of 2008

To revise the requirements for seller-financed downpayments for mortgages for single-family housing insured by the Secretary of Housing and Urban Development under title II of the National Housing Act and to authorize risk-based insurance premiums for certain mortgagors under such mortgages. view all titles (2)
